J Re: Mitchell v. Wachovia, et al.
D.De1., C.A. No. 06—725 (GMS)
Dear Judge Sleet:
I am writing to confirm that the parties have agreed to engage in a mediation conference,
4 . with Judge (Retired) Vincent A. Bifferato, Sr., on April 29, 2008. The parties determined that it was
to their mutual advantage to attempt to resolve the case prior to the pretrial conference which is
scheduled for May 1, 2008. Unfortunately, we could not obtain a mediation date with Magistrate
Stark prior to the date of the pretrial conference. Under the circumstances, therefore, the parties
agreed to a private mediator. Of course, we will notify the Court promptly of the result of the
mediation effort. ·
We thank the Court for its consideration of this matter.
